Abstract

A new NLO crystal L-Threonine doped Potassium Bromide (LTPB) crystal is reported by synthesis and growth along with the comparison of pure L-Threonine. Grown crystals of LTPB crystals are characterized with UV-Vis-NIR, FTIR, Powder XRD, TG-DSC, and SHG. Clear crystals of very good transparency were harvested by slow evaporation technique at room temperature. Inclusion is confirmed with the change in the structure of materials using Xrd pattern. FTIR spectrum exposes the available functional groups in the grown crystal to confirm the new arrival. TG-DSC spectra show the thermal properties of LTPB found that the thermal stability extends up to 750°C. The basic optical behavior of the grown crystal was examined using absorption and transmittance spectra obtained from UV-Vis-NIR spectra. The efficiency of SHG of the LTPB crystal was recorded using Kurtz powder method.
